- Title
Human ubiquitin-protein ligase Nedd4: expression, subcellular localization and selective interaction with ubiquitin-conjugating enzymes.
- Authors
Anan, T; Nagata, Y; Koga, H; Honda, Y; Yabuki, N; Miyamoto, C; Kuwano, A; Matsuda, I; Endo, F; Saya, H; Nakao, M
- Abstract
Nedd4 is a ubiquitin-protein ligase containing a calcium/lipid-binding domain, multiple WW domains and a C-terminal Hect domain, which is required for both the ubiquitin transfer and the association with E2 ubiquitin-conjugating enzymes. Nedd4 has been reported to be involved in the selective ubiquitination of some regulatory proteins in transcription and membrane transport.
